Ely (pronounced to rhyme with mealy) is a cathedral city in east Cambridgeshire, East Anglia.
Ely is on the River Great Ouse and was a significant port until the 18th century.
The Cathedral Church of the Holy and Undivided Trinity of Ely was started by William I in 1083 and completed in 1351, despite the collapse of the main tower in 1322, which was rebuilt as a octagonal tower.
